Light responsive nucleic acid for biomedical application

Abstract

Nucleic acids are widely used in biomedical applications because of their programmability and biocompatibility. The light responsive nucleic acids have attracted wide attention due to their remote control and high spatiotemporal resolution. In this review, we summarized the latest developments in biomedicine of light responsive molecules. The molecules which confer light responsive properties to nucleic acids were summarized. The binding sites of molecules to nucleic acids, the induced structural changes, and functional regulation of nucleic acids were reviewed. Then, the biomedical applications of light responsive nucleic acids were listed, such as drug delivery, biosensing, optogenetics, gene editing, etc. Finally, the challenges were discussed and possible future directions of light-responsive nucleic acids were proposed.
